TOPManchester City exit date anticipated for Kalvin Phillips as permanent transfer looms

Kalvin Phillips' permanent departure from Manchester City is delayed until he recovers from an Achilles injury sustained during surgery at the end of May, with his return not expected until August. His exit, however, is considered a near certainty in the coming weeks. Phillips has struggled to establish himself at City since joining from Leeds United in 2022, failing to secure consistent playing time amid strong competition, notably from Rodri, compounded by injuries and form issues. Loan spells at West Ham United in the latter part of the 2023/24 season and more recently at Ipswich Town failed to reignite his best form or suggest a future at City. With Manchester City's squad evolving and new midfield additions arriving this summer, Phillips' pathway to the first team has further narrowed. The player himself is understood to be pushing for a permanent move away, and the club will not stand in his way following his underwhelming loan spells. Several Premier League clubs, particularly those lower down the table or newly promoted, are expected to be interested, valuing his experience, ball-winning ability, leadership, and proven quality from his time at Leeds. For Manchester City, a permanent sale would represent a clean break, facilitate squad adjustment by opening opportunities for emerging talents, and clear significant salary space.

TOPELF playoff race intensifies as teams jockey for postseason berths

The European League of Football playoff race remains undecided after Week 9, with no team clinching a postseason spot. Six teams currently lead the chase for the Championship Game, while several others maintain playoff hopes following multiple games decided late. The Vienna Vikings (7-1) strengthened their position as the top seed with a close road win over the Paris Musketeers, aided by a strong strength of victory metric. The Munich Ravens (7-1) also stand at 7-1 after defeating the Helvetic Mercenaries, setting up a critical Week 10 matchup against the Raiders Tirol that could shape their semifinal path. Current projections show the Raiders Tirol (5-3) facing the unbeaten Nordic Storm (8-0) in the wildcard round, despite Storm's narrow win over Rhein Fire and lower strength of victory keeping them as the #3 seed. The Stuttgart Surge (6-2) temporarily hold a home wildcard game after routing Frankfurt, but face a Week 10 challenge against the dangerous #5 Paris Musketeers (5-3), led by quarterback Jaylon Henderson. Five teams remain within two wins of a playoff berth, including the surging Madrid Bravos and Wroclaw Panthers. The Rhein Fire (4-4), Prague Lions (4-4), and Frankfurt Galaxy (3-5) need strong finishes to avoid elimination, while the Berlin Thunder (3-5) face significant challenges after three consecutive losses. Key matchups in Weeks 10-12 will determine the final playoff participants. The Fehervar Enthroners (0-8) and Cologne Centurions (0-8) became the first teams mathematically eliminated, having struggled with quarterback inconsistency and defensive issues throughout the season. With three weeks remaining in the closest ELF playoff race to date, the final stretch promises dramatic shifts. Top seeds Vienna and Munich aim to secure first-round byes, while the unbeaten Nordic Storm seeks to validate their record. Bubble teams like Madrid and Rhein Fire have no margin for error, making every play crucial for postseason positioning.

They learned nothing from the Cooper Kupp contract
The article argues against the Washington Commanders giving receiver Terry McLaurin, who is 30 years old and threatening a holdout, a massive new contract by comparing it to the Los Angeles Rams' perceived mistake with Cooper Kupp. The Rams gave Kupp a 3-year, $80 million deal after his Super Bowl win when he was younger than McLaurin is now, but subsequently paid him roughly $70 million for the worst seasons of his career. It contends that wide receivers typically hit a performance decline between ages 29 and 31, supported by historical evidence. While exceptions like Jerry Rice and Larry Fitzgerald had Pro Bowl seasons later in their careers, the article notes they had to change their playing style, transitioning from outside deep threats to possession slot receivers. Crucially, possession receivers command significantly less money than elite deep threats. The piece points out that Kupp, despite being a possession slot receiver when he won Offensive Player of the Year, has already shown decline: his yards per catch dropped from 12.7 in his first five seasons to 11.2 in the past three, and his per-game average fell from 79.1 yards in his 20s to 60 yards in his 30s. His reduced role, partly due to the emergence of rookie Puka Nacua, exemplifies the article's final point: smart teams rely on cost-effective receivers on rookie contracts (like Nacua earning $1 million) rather than overpaying aging stars demanding $30 million, as it's easier to get net positive value.
NWSL and US Soccer’s lack of transgender policy targeted by conservative lobby groups
The National Women's Soccer League (NWSL) has confirmed that its 2021 policy on transgender athlete participation is no longer in effect and has not been since Commissioner Jessica Berman was hired in March 2022. The league currently operates with no policy on transgender players, despite widespread belief that the 2021 rules were still active. The 2021 policy allowed male-to-female transgender athletes to compete if they declared their gender identity as female and maintained testosterone levels "within typical limits of women athletes." It barred female-to-male transgender athletes undergoing testosterone therapy from competing. While no known transgender athletes currently play in the NWSL, past players include Canadian Olympian Quinn and Japan's Kumi Yokoyama, who criticized the policy. The NWSL did not explain why the policy lapsed or if a new one is planned. This development occurs alongside England's and Scotland's Football Associations banning transgender women from women's football following a UK Supreme Court ruling defining "woman" as biological sex. The United States Soccer Federation (USSF) also lacks a policy for national teams, citing no elite transgender players in their pool. For amateur players, USSF policy allows registration based on gender identity with supporting documentation. The absence of clear policies from major US soccer authorities exists within a contentious national climate. The US Supreme Court recently allowed Tennessee's ban on gender-affirming care and will hear cases on transgender sports bans this fall. Advocacy organizations like Human Rights Campaign and Athlete Ally declined to comment, reflecting reduced public support. Lobby groups view this policy vacuum as an opportunity to push for bans, with a legal advisor noting "the tide is changing" in the US regarding transgender participation in sports.

Jets star faces make-or-break year with payday on the line

Breece Hall's 2023 season was a breakout success for the New York Jets, as the running back amassed over 1,500 scrimmage yards and nine touchdowns, cementing his status as a rising star despite recovering from an ACL tear. Hall's performance significantly regressed in 2024, marked by fewer explosive runs, six fumbles, and a career-low 4.2 yards per carry. He later attributed part of this decline to playing through a serious knee issue, which also led to trade rumors clouding his future with the Jets. A key factor in his 2023 success was creative offensive usage by coaches Nathaniel Hackett and Todd Downing, who moved Hall around the formation to maximize his speed. This approach changed in 2024 as the Jets attempted to shift Hall into a more traditional between-the-tackles runner. Under new coaches Aaron Glenn and Darren Mougey, the Jets are expected to transition to a rotational backfield strategy. Offensive coordinator Tanner Engstrand, who previously developed Jahmyr Gibbs, aims to utilize Hall similarly as a dual-threat back, aligning with modern NFL trends favoring efficiency and explosion over heavy workloads. Supporting backs Braelon Allen and Isaiah Davis provide solid depth, but the most encouraging development for a potential Hall bounce-back is the significantly improved offensive line. The unit, featuring first-round pick Armand Membou alongside Olu Fashanu, John Simpson, Joe Tippmann, and Alijah Vera-Tucker, is now considered one of the league's most athletic and promising, tailored for a versatile back like Hall. Hall faces a crucial contract year in 2024. With the Jets also needing to extend other key 2022 first-round picks like Sauce Gardner, Jermaine Johnson, and the recently extended Garrett Wilson, the improved scheme, offensive line, and supporting cast are in place. The onus is now on Hall to prove he remains a franchise cornerstone worthy of a second contract.

Ranking the 5 greatest transfer signings in Arsenal history

Arsenal's ability to contend for the Premier League title next season hinges on signing a new striker, with Viktor Gyökeres heavily linked, though negotiations with Sporting Lisbon are currently deadlocked. Historically strong recruitment under Arsène Wenger yielded three league titles, but finances were strained after the 2006 Emirates Stadium move, leading to a title drought and key player sales. Despite a recent resurgence under Mikel Arteta, he faces pressure to deliver the league title, making strategic recruitment critical. The club's five greatest signings include Sol Campbell, who controversially joined from rivals Tottenham. The defender won two Premier League titles and reached the Champions League final with Arsenal before later managerial struggles. David Seaman joined from QPR and became a legendary goalkeeper, making 563 appearances. His era featured a formidable defense that secured two league titles and the UEFA Cup Winners' Cup, Arsenal's last European trophy. Patrick Vieira anchored midfield during three title-winning campaigns, known for his rivalry with Roy Keane. Post-Arsenal, he played in Italy and England before managing Crystal Palace and currently Genoa. Dennis Bergkamp, nicknamed the "Non-Flying Dutchman" for his fear of flying, contributed 120 goals and 116 assists in 422 games. Despite missing European away matches, his technical brilliance left an indelible mark. He now coaches in Ajax's youth system. Thierry Henry arrived from Juventus and became Arsenal's record scorer with 228 goals, winning two league titles before joining Barcelona. He later returned for a loan spell from the New York Red Bulls.

Superman star slams Kryptonian ability for Jalen Hurts in startling Eagles verdict

David Corenswet, the actor cast as the new Superman and a lifelong Philadelphia Eagles fan, was asked whether he would trust Superman or Eagles quarterback Jalen Hurts to successfully execute the team's signature "tush push" play on a critical fourth-and-short situation. Corenswet unequivocally chose Jalen Hurts. Corenswet explained his choice, stating he expects "a lot more technique and organization involved in the mechanics and success of the tush push than meets the eye." He humorously suggested Superman might simply "end up tripping over his feet or something," emphasizing his respect for Hurts by formally referring to him as "Mr. Hurts." This endorsement highlights Corenswet's genuine Eagles fandom, evidenced by his frequent appearances in Eagles gear and support for Philly brands like Wawa. The actor's choice underscores the intricate skill required for the play and spotlights Hurts' exceptional execution. Statistics support this dominance: since 2022, the Eagles have converted a staggering 87% of their tush pushes, far exceeding the league average of 71%. Furthermore, 33 of Hurts' 55 career rushing touchdowns have come from just one yard out, including 15 in 2023 and 14 in 2024, consistently outperforming elite running backs. His low-center power and timing are unmatched. While opponents anticipate the play, stopping it proves extremely difficult, a feat credited not only to Hurts but also to the perfectly synchronized offensive line. The play is central to the Eagles' identity, forming the core of their second-ranked rushing attack which scored 29 touchdowns in 2024. Corenswet's playful admission, coincidentally sharing a birthday (July 8th) with the Eagles franchise, confirms that Hurts possesses a unique "superpower": flawless execution under immense pressure. This ability to master the complex, violent ballet of the tush push in critical moments is fundamental to the Eagles' offensive success and championship aspirations.

Bundesliga to recieve €1.346 billion per season from domestic TV rights

The Bundesliga will receive €1.346 billion per season for its domestic TV rights covering the 2025/26 to 2028/29 seasons. This amount is significantly lower than the Premier League's equivalent €7.76 billion for the same period. This domestic revenue will be distributed among Bundesliga clubs based on specific criteria: 50% is split equally, giving each club €25.5 million; 43% is allocated based on sporting performance over the past five to ten years; 4% is awarded for using young players; and the final 3% depends on the level of interest in the clubs. Additionally, income from the league's international TV rights deal, though substantially smaller than the domestic amount, will also be added to each club's total. The top three earners from the domestic TV deal are Bayern Munich (€83.4 million), Borussia Dortmund (€78 million), and Bayer Leverkusen (€75 million). Newly promoted Hamburg will receive the least, totaling €31.4 million.

Ravens $16 million 2-time Pro Bowler named most underpaid at his position

The Baltimore Ravens possess one of the NFL's strongest rosters, excelling on both offense and defense, led by star quarterback Lamar Jackson. Key offseason moves included re-signing offensive tackle Ronnie Stanley and acquiring wide receiver DeAndre Hopkins. The team now aims to reach the Super Bowl for the first time in the Jackson era, with safety Kyle Hamilton expected to play a crucial role in that pursuit. Hamilton, drafted 14th overall by the Ravens in 2022, has quickly established himself as a top player, earning two Pro Bowl selections and a First-team All-Pro honor (2023) already. The Ravens have secured him through 2026 by picking up his fifth-year option, meaning he will become a free agent in 2027. Bleacher Report's Alex Kay identified Hamilton as the league's most underpaid safety, highlighting his remarkably low 2025 salary cap hit of just over $5 million. Kay praised Hamilton's exceptional versatility, stating he excels equally against the run and in coverage while also being effective as a blitzer. Hamilton's career statistics (250 tackles, 27 pass defenses, 5 interceptions, 4 forced fumbles) further cement his status as an elite player. Given his performance and recent contract extensions signed by safeties Kerby Joseph and Antoine Winfield Jr. (setting a floor around $21 million), Kay anticipates Hamilton will soon receive a significant financial reward commensurate with his elite standing in the game.
